# Hardware Lab Access — Contractors

Lab B2 at Tindry Works is restricted. Contractors must sign the logbook at the front desk first. No tools leave the lab without inspection. Escort required after 18:00. ESD straps mandatory at all benches.

The lab door uses a keypad; enter with the contractor code below.

door code, yagap-bahof: bdg-O-05

### Action item: tame the reconcile job

Quick one for release planning: the nightly Stockfern inventory reconciliation blew past its window again because batch sizes were guessed, not measured. We've now load-tested against the Harvale replica and pinned sane defaults in config. Please gate the next release on these being deployed everywhere. The constants we're shipping are below.

tuning constants:
QUOTAS = {
    "druwyn": 5,
    "holix": 5,
    "zorath": 5,
    "holwyn": 10,
}

The VramScope profiler in the Kestrelline training stack reads its configuration entirely from the environment. Set VRAMSCOPE_SAMPLE_MS to control sampling cadence (default 250) and VRAMSCOPE_OUTPUT_DIR for trace dumps. Profiling runs on the Ortavale cluster must also enable VRAMSCOPE_PER_DEVICE=1, or multi-GPU traces will be merged incorrectly. Future maintainers: do not hardcode these in the launcher script. Finally, uploading traces to the shared dashboard requires authentication, so add the following line to your env file.

vault entry, kafog-yahop: COURIER_KEY8=0faa53ae

Autoscaler runbook, QFlux. Scaling is driven by queue depth, not CPU. If workers flap, check the cooldown setting first — default is 90s. Never set min replicas below 2; drains take too long. Manual override: pause the controller, scale by hand, unpause within 30 min or it reverts. Full parameter reference and escalation steps are on the internal page below.

operations page: https://jenkins.zemvarcloud.local/job/merge_requests/repo/build/73930b4b30f0a8ed

## Authentication

Migrations via `shiftgate` run dual-write, backfill, then cutover. Zero downtime depends on the Corvane schema registry accepting both versions during the window. Auth is required before any plan is applied; anonymous dry-runs are disabled in prod. Tokens are scoped per-environment and expire after 12 hours. Rotate before long backfills. The registry client reads one credential from the environment. Set it on the line below.

gateway credential: kto23_LX9A4ys6i4nzHtpOLNLodKK